Fan-out backpressure for the Quillet notifier: when the queue depth crosses the soft limit, the dispatcher sheds low-priority pushes and batches the rest at 500ms intervals. Reviewer should confirm the shed counter is exported and that retries respect the jitter window. Once merged, the release artifact gets re-signed by the pipeline, which expects the deploy key shown below.

deploy key for bawep-yawif: bky6_GQhaSt

Quarterly Planning Note — Pilot Churn, Project Amberfold

For the finance team: churn in the Amberfold pilot hit 9% this quarter, above the 6% assumption in the revenue model. Exit interviews point to onboarding friction rather than pricing. We will rebase the pilot forecast, extend the trial period for remaining cohorts, and hold marketing spend steady. The implications for next year's targets are covered in the confidential business-plan note below.

management briefing: Gross margin on Ralael came in at 15 percent against a plan of 10 percent. Only 9 of the 100 pilot accounts renewed Ralael, so a churn review is set for April 1.

Ticket TZ-4412 — Signature verification failed on report export bundle

The nightly export from Ledgervane's reporting service failed its signature check after the timezone normalization patch shipped. Timestamps are now serialized in UTC, which changed the payload hash against the cached manifest. Re-signing with the current key resolves it in staging. To unblock the on-call rotation, verify exports against the active signing key, which is:

signing key of yajop-hahog = bky4_eXoX

## Runbook: StockSync Nightly Reconciliation

Quick context for the security review: StockSync compares warehouse counts in LedgerBin against the storefront totals in Cartwheel every night at 02:00. If the drift exceeds 0.5%, it opens a discrepancy ticket and pauses outbound fulfillment for the affected SKUs. To rerun manually, trigger the `stocksync-recon` job from the Pipeline console. The job authenticates to the LedgerBin internal API with the key below.

service key, fawip-bajef: kto11_Qt5wZK9vdNC